>Hey guys, how 'bout just using loadlin?  Should work right off the
>FAT32 partition from DOS, and won't care which cylinder the Linux
>partition starts.  Set your Win to not start the GUI automatically,
>then run loadlin from the DOS prompt.  It's worked for me to get
>around weird drive issues.  I can send you my config for this if you
>like.

You can even boot Windows in the GUI mode.  There is a package called 
Linux-95 that puts an icon on your desktop that boots you into Linux.
